Welcome to a beautifully renovated home just minutes from the heart of Grapevine’s historic Main Street and zoned to highly regarded Grapevine-Colleyville ISD schools, including Cannon Elementary. Thoughtfully updated from top to bottom, this home blends timeless character with modern style and everyday comfort. Step inside to an open and inviting layout filled with designer finishes, including custom white oak cabinetry, sleek quartz countertops, stainless steel appliances, and a kitchen designed for both entertaining and daily living. The kitchen flows seamlessly into the dining and living areas, where a cozy fireplace creates a warm and welcoming atmosphere. Upstairs, the spacious primary suite offers a private retreat with a beautifully updated bathroom and walk-in shower. The secondary bedrooms are bright and generously sized, offering flexibility for guests, a home office, or additional living space. Outside, the expansive cedar-covered patio provide the perfect setting for summer barbecues, gatherings, or peaceful evenings outdoors. The location is hard to beat—just minutes from Hotel Vin, Grapevine’s restaurants, shopping, and entertainment, as well as TEXRail access to DFW Airport and Fort Worth. With convenient access to major highways and everything Grapevine has to offer, this is the home you’ve been waiting for.

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
